A Missouri man was arrested after he called 911 early Saturday evening to report that he’d just killed three family members at his home.
Greene County deputies arrived and took Jesse Huy, 50, into custody without incident, charging him the with murders of his wife and her parents.
Tonya Huy, 48, Ronald Koehler, 71, and Linda Koehler, 78, were all shot to death, the sheriff’s office said.
The county prosecutor charged Huy with three counts of first degree murder and three counts of armed criminal action.
Investigators have not revealed what may have led to the shootings. KY3 said that Huy has no criminal record in Missouri.
